2 / 14 page 2 AT88SC25616C 5017DS–SMEM–7/04 Description The AT88SC25616C member of the CryptoMemory family is a high-performance secure memory providing 256 Kbits of user memory with advanced security and cryptographic features built in. The user memory is divided into 16 2-byte zones, each of which may be individually set with different security access rights or combined together to provide space for 1 to 4 data files. Smart Card Applications The AT88SC25616C provides high security, low cost, and ease of implementation with- out the need for a microprocessor operating system. The embedded cryptographic engine provides for dynamic, symmetric-mutual authentication between the device and host, as well as performing stream encryption for all data and passwords exchanged between the device and host. Up to four unique key sets may be used for these opera- tions. The AT88SC25616C offers the ability to communicate with virtually any smart card reader using the asynchronous T = 0 protocol (Gemplus Patent) defined in ISO 7816-3. Communication speeds up to 153,600 baud are supported by utilizing ISO 7816-3 Protocol and Parameter Selection. Embedded Applications Through dynamic, symmetric-mutual authentication, data encryption, and the use of encrypted checksums, the AT88SC25616C provides a secure place for storage of sen- sitive information within a system. With its tamper detection circuits, this information remains safe even under attack. A 2-wire serial interface running at 1.5 MHz is used for fast and efficient communications with up to 15 devices that may be individually addressed. The AT88SC25616C is available in industry standard 8-lead packages with the same familiar pinout as 2-wire serial EEPROMs. Figure 1. Block Diagram Pin Descriptions Supply Voltage (V CC) The V CC input is a 2.7V to 5.5V positive voltage supplied by the host. Clock (SCL/CLK) In the asynchronous T = 0 protocol, the SCL/CLK input is used to provide the device with a carrier frequency f. The nominal length of one bit emitted on I/O is defined as an “elementary time unit” (ETU) and is equal to 372/f. When the synchronous protocol is used, the SCL/CLK input is used to positive edge clock data into the device and negative edge clock data out of the device.
